What is chaos engineering?

Dynatrace

Testing for mishaps you can predict is essential. Chaos engineering is a method of testing distributed software that deliberately introduces failure and faulty scenarios to verify its resilience in the face of random disruptions. Practitioners subject software to a controlled, simulated crisis to test for unstable behavior.

What is web application security? Everything you need to know.

Dynatrace

Examples range from online banking to personal entertainment delivery and e-commerce. Web application security is the process of protecting web applications against various types of threats that are designed to exploit vulnerabilities in an application’s code.
